After the U.S. Supreme Court heard oral arguments today in the landmark marriage equality case, Congresswoman Debbie Dingell (MI-12) and the Congressional LGBT Equality Caucus hosted a reception honoring Michigan couple April DeBoer and Jayne Rowse. April and Jayne are plaintiffs in DeBoer vs. Snyder, part of the consolidated marriage case heard before the Supreme Court.

"April and Jayne are devoted partners and loving, caring parents who want to be able to protect their children and have their love for each other recognized by the law." said Dingell. "It was an honor to introduce these amazing women to my colleagues today; they reminded us that love can't wait, and I am confident that because of April and Jayne's courage and willingness to stand up for what is right, all families are closer to receiving the equal justice they deserve."
